Brian’s Obituary Brian Christopher Dauphinais, age 29, of Mason, passed away on February 2, 2019. He was born October 30, 1989 in Ashland, the son of Raymond and Theresa “Joni” (Seipel) Dauphinais. Brian is survived by his father, 3 sisters, Sarah Dauphinais, River Falls, WI, Diana (Tyler) Blain, Orem, Utah, and Charlotte Dauphinais; 2 brothers, Scott (Kayla) Dauphinais, Richfield,WI and Adam (Sarah) Dauphinais, St. Louis, MO; 2 nieces, Aubrey Blain and Autumn Dauphinais; 4 nephews, Owen Dauphinais, Logan Blain, William Dauphinais, and Marshall Blain. He is preceded in death by his mother. Brian attended Drummond School until he transferred to Mellen after his sophomore year, graduating in 2008. He then attended Northland College, graduating in 2012 with a Bachelor of Science degree, majoring in Environmental Science and minoring in Biololgy. After graduating from Northland he began his PhD at the University of Southern Mississippi, studying Polymer Engineering. Before finishing his PhD he returned home to assist his father in taking care of his Mother during her final years. While at Northland he achieved the Dean List several times. He also co-authored 2 national publications: Synthesis of High Molecular Weight Polyesters via In Vacuo Dehydrogenation Polymerization of Diols; and Controlled Hydrogenative Depolymerization of Polyesters and Polycarbonates Catalyzed by Ruthenium (II) PNN Pincer Complexes. He also received 3 scholarships while attending Northland: the Lake Superior Scholarship; the Lockhart Scholarship; and the Legacy Scholarship. During his high school career he participated on the high school basketball teams for Drummond and Mellen. He also enjoyed fishing with his father and watching sports on television with him. His favorite teams to watch were the Green Bay Packers, Milwaukee Bucks, and the Wisconsin Badgers football and basketball teams. There will be a memorial service on Saturday, July, 27, 2019 at 1:00 pm at the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ints, 1405 Binsfield Rd, Ashland, WI. The Frost Home for Funerals is assisting the family with arrangements. Read More
